Continuing our quest in 2016, we announced a partnership with Princi, a renowned boutique bakery and café founded by Rocco Princi in 1986. Known for its artisan breads created from traditional family recipes, Princi’s six locations have become beloved experiences for customers across Milan and London.

Through the shared values for handcrafted experiences, Starbucks will expand standalone Princi specialty stores and begin including fresh baking in Starbucks Roasteries and Reserve stores, with the first opening in New York City in 2018.

The savory cook I contributes to Starbucks success by organizing and executing food preparation in large quantities. Assists Head Savory Chef in food production for all food locations, catering events, and other functions. Candidate will assist with food production tasks as needed, and ensures that quality and cost standards are consistently attained.

As a savory cook I , using past culinary experience, the candidate will:

  • Prepare a wide variety of savory products, soups and sauces according to prescribed recipes.

  • Assist with inventories, pricing, cost controls, requisitioning, and issuing supplies and equipment for food production.

  • Assist with sanitation and safety, menu planning, and related production activities.

  • Clean and maintain work areas, utensils, and equipment.

  • Make recommendations for maintenance, repair and upkeep of the kitchen, its equipment, and other areas as appropriate.

  • Consistently maintain standards of quality, cost, presentation, and flavor of foods.

  • Perform miscellaneous job-related duties as assigned.

  • Provide training and coaching for staff as needed

Summary of Experience

  • Food Service and Production Experience - 2 years

  • Local Health Code and Safety Certifications

  • Culinary Degree Preferred
